## Authentication

The Kerbstone address autocomplete widget requires a server-side token exchange; never ship raw credentials to the browser. Your backend calls the Kerbstone gateway, receives a short-lived session token, and hands that to the widget at init. Rate limits apply per key, not per session, so one key covers all environments in a release train. Rotate before each GA cut. For staging verification during this release, use the internal service key below.

API key for kafop-fafof: qvz3-4pw

# Settings for the Grainsort CSV import wizard.
# Security notes: uploads are scanned before parsing, and rows failing
# validation are quarantined rather than inserted. Column mappings are
# user-supplied but sanitized against the schema allowlist. Temp files
# are deleted after each run. The wizard writes accepted rows to the
# staging database defined by the connection string below.

primary connection of tawif-yajeg = postgresql://rusiel_svc:G879q9cx6GsSvj@db-dd9f.norvagrid.internal:5432/casath

Visitor lockers — changing rooms, Ferncastle Athletics Annexe. Reception staff assign each visitor one locker in the ground-floor changing rooms at sign-in; record the locker number against the visitor's name in the day log. Visitors must clear lockers before departure, and any items left after closing are moved to the lost-property cupboard. Do not assign lockers 1–6, which are reserved for duty staff. Staff opening the changing-room corridor at the start of a visitor booking should use the access code below.

door code, yagap-bahof: bdg-O-05